        Highly selective iron-based Fischer-Tropsch catalysts activated by CO<sub>2</sub>-containing syngas

        Chun, D.H.,Park, J.C.,Hong, S.Y.,Lim, J.T.,Kim, C.S.,Lee, H.T.,Yang, J.I.,Hong, S.,Jung, H. Academic Press 2014 Journal of catalysis Vol.317 No.-

        Fischer-Tropsch synthesis (FTS) was carried out over precipitated iron-based catalysts activated by syngas (H<SUB>2</SUB>+CO) with different amounts of CO<SUB>2</SUB> (0%, 20%, 33%, and 50%). The activation using CO<SUB>2</SUB>-containing syngas significantly suppressed the production of undesired products, CH<SUB>4</SUB> and C<SUB>2</SUB>-C<SUB>4</SUB> hydrocarbons, but facilitated the production of valuable products, C<SUB>5+</SUB> hydrocarbons. In particular, in the case of C<SUB>19+</SUB> hydrocarbons, the target products of low-temperature FTS (≤280<SUP>o</SUP>C), both selectivity and productivity showed a great increase with an increased inlet CO<SUB>2</SUB> content during activation. We attribute the advantageous performance of the catalysts activated by CO<SUB>2</SUB>-containing syngas to the improvement in the effective performance of active iron carbides, possibly induced by an increased ratio of ε'-carbide (Fe<SUB>2.2</SUB>C) to χ-carbide (Fe<SUB>2.5</SUB>C) and a decreased fraction of inactive bulk carbons.

        Microstructural evolution and tensile properties of oxide dispersion strengthened Alloy 617 at elevated temperatures

        Chun, Y.B.,Mao, X.,Han, C.H.,Jang, J. Elsevier Sequoia 2017 Materials science & engineering Structural materia Vol.706 No.-

        <P><B>Abstract</B></P> <P>This study investigated evolution of the microstructure of oxide dispersion strengthened Alloy 617 with annealing temperature. A mixture of prealloyed Alloy 617 and Y<SUB>2</SUB>O<SUB>3</SUB> powders was mechanically alloyed and consolidated by hot-extrusion at 1100°C. Hot extrusion developed a submicron-sized grain structure with M<SUB>23</SUB>C<SUB>6</SUB> carbides and finely dispersed Al<SUB>2</SUB>O<SUB>3</SUB> and Y<SUB>2</SUB>Ti<SUB>2</SUB>O<SUB>7</SUB> oxides. The fine-grained structure was stable during subsequent annealing at temperatures up to 1250°C. Further increase of annealing temperature to 1300°C resulted in a significantly coarsened grain structure, which was coincident with the abrupt coarsening of oxides. M<SUB>23</SUB>C<SUB>6</SUB> carbides in the as-extruded conditions were transformed to M<SUB>7</SUB>C<SUB>3</SUB> carbides with complex shapes when annealed at 1200°C, and their shapes changed to very coarse hexagonal prisms at 1250°C, which was followed by the formation of eutectic M<SUB>2</SUB>C carbides at grain boundaries at 1300°C. Tensile tests of the as-extruded ODS Alloy 617 showed that the yield strength decreased steeply at a transition temperature of around 600°C, which can be attributed to diffusional creep along the grain boundaries.</P>

        Diamond 박막 성장에 미치는 Si 표면 영향의 AES에 의한 연구

        이철로(C. R. Lee),신용현(Y. H. Shin),임재영(J. Y. Leem),정광화(K. H. Chung),천병선(B. S. Chun) 한국진공학회(ASCT) 1993 Applied Science and Convergence Technology Vol.2 No.2

        Si 기판 표면상태 변화와 관련된 핵생성 자유에너지 증가에 따른 다이아몬드 박막성장 거동을 관찰하였다. 표면 연마조건 변화에 따른 3가지 기판(A-Si, B-Si, C-Si) 위에 동일한 성장조건으로 다이아몬드를 성장하였으며, 이때 형상인자와 관련된 자유에너지 관계는 ΔG_(A-Si)<ΔG_(B-Si)<ΔG_(C-Si)이다. AES, SEM, XRD, RHEED에 의해 각각의 박막 A, B, C를 조사한 결과, 핵생성 자유에너지가 가장 적은 A 박막은 (100) (110) 면이 지배적인 고품위 다이아몬드 박막이다. 자유에너지가 A에 비해 다소 적은 B 박막은 (111) 면이 지배적인 8면체 다이아몬드 박막이고, 자유에너지가 가장 적은 C 박막은 흑연이 많이 함유된 구상의 다이아몬드이다. The effect of nucleation free energy related to Si surface states on diamond film growth behavior has been studied. At first, the three kinds of diamond thin films (A, B, C) were deposited on various Si substrates (A-Si, B-Si, C-Si) whose surfaces were polished with 1 ㎛ diamond paste, 6 ㎛ Al₂O₃ powder and 12 ㎛ Al₂O₃ powder respectively. And then, relative nucleation free energy calculated is ΔG_(A-Si)<ΔG_(B-Si)<ΔG_(c-Si) Although there are some difference in grain size, shape and nucleation site, the thin films on A-Si and B-Si were diamond including a small amount of DLC which was confirmed by AES, SEM, XRD and RHEED. Namely, the diamonds of films (B) were not nucleated in scratches but in dents and larger in grain size compare with the film (C) of which diamond were nucleated not only scratches but also dents. And, the sphere diamond which is not general shape was grown on C-Si. After all, the sphere was turned out to be the diamond including much graphite as a result of the AES in situ depth profiling. Consequently, the diamond shape and quality grown on Si were changed from the crystal which the (100) and (110) planes were predominent to the crystal in which (111) plane was predominent, and next to sphere shape diamond including much graphite according as the nucleation free energy increases.

        EACVD로 Si 위에 성장한 다이아몬드 박막의 계면 접합강도

        이철로(C. R. Lee),박재홍(J. H. Park),임재영(J. Y. Leem),김관식(K. S. Kim),천병선(B. S. Chun) 한국진공학회(ASCT) 1993 Applied Science and Convergence Technology Vol.2 No.3

        필라멘트와 Si 기판 사이의 기전력을 20, 80, 140, 200V로 증가시키면서 EACVD에 의하여 성장된 다이아몬드 박막에 대하여 다이아몬드/Si 계면분석 및 계면강도를 측정하였다. 주사형전자현미경(SEM), 고분해능투과형전자현미경(HRTEM), 오제이전자분석기(AES)에 의해 계면상태를 분석한 결과, 기전력 증가에 따라 활성탄화수소 이온(C_mH_n^-) 에너지가 증가되어져 C_mH_n^-이 Si내로 침투(Impringement)가 증가되고 침투된 높은 에너지의 C_mH_n^-이 Si과 화학결합하여 생성되는 SiC층 깊이 및 농도 분포도 증가된다. 풀 시험(Pull test)에 의한 계면강도 측정 결과, SiC층 깊이 및 농도분포가 증가할수록 계면강도가 증가하였다. 관찰된 파면과 파면의 X-선 메핑 결과 및 HRTEM과 AES에 의한 분석 결과, 기전력 증가에 따라 공극율이 적고 치밀한 다이아몬드 박막이 성장된다. 그리고 생성되는 SiC층 농도 및 깊이 분포가 증가함에 따라 다이아몬드/Si 계면이 강화되고, 상대적으로 파괴는 다이아몬드/Si 계면이 아닌 SiC층이나 Si 내부에서 발생된다. 결국, 기전력을 증가하여 활성탄화수소 이온의 에너지를 증가함으로써 계면강도가 우수하며 공극율이 매우 적고 치밀한 다이아몬드 박막을 성장할 수 있다. The diamond thin films on Si which 20 V (Film A), 80 V (Film B), 140 V (Film C) and 200 V (Film D) had been applied respectively between filament and Si substrates during growth were analysed with SEM, HRTEM and AES. Judging from those results, the diffusion of carbon increased due to the increment of the energy of active hydrocarbon ion (C_mH_n^-) and also the SiC layers were formed as the result of chemical bonding of C_mH_n^- with Si. The amount and depth of SiC layer increased as the potentials increased. The interface adhesion of these films were also measured with Pull test which is the most accurate and general method in evaluation of thin film adhesion. The film (D) which SiC was formed most deeply and widely exhibited the most adhesion in diamond/Si interface. Meanwhiles, the film (A) which had most shallow SiC layer and low SiC concentration exhibited very weak adhesion compare to film (D). Judging from the observation and X-Ray Mapping of fracture surface, the film (D) was fractured in Si below interface and the film (A) was fractured in diamond thin film/Si interface. Also, there are many voids in film (A) and a little in film (D). Conclusively, it is possible to grow the high strength and condensed diamond thin film without pores because the energy of active hydrocarbon ion was increased by elevation of potentials during growth.

        칡소의 염색체 양상과 핵형 분석

        손시환,고영두,김두환,박구부,이정규,이철영,신철교,정희식,곽석준,박명구,천민성,백철승 한국축산학회 2000 한국축산학회지 Vol.42 No.1

        The Korean Native Stripped Cattle known as Chickso have distinctive black hair belts all over the body to varying extents on a Hanwoo(Korean Cattle)-like yellowish brown background. These Battle are remaining only in a limited area of this country and are known to yield a flavorful meat somewhat distinct from that of Hanwoo, but their genetic lineage has not been identified. We have carried out karyotyping of these cattle firm the lymphocyte culture. Blood samples were collected from 20 of male and female cattle that had been bred at Poongjeon Farm located in Kosong, Kyongnam, and were subjected to chromosomal morphology and G- and C-banding analysis. Chickso, like Hanwoo, had 58 autosomes and X and Y sex chromosomes which were morphologically very similar to those of the latter. All the 58 autosomes revealed almost a zero value of centromeric index, suggesting that they are acrocentric; sex chromosomes X and Y were submetacentric and metacentric, respectively. Following G-banding, the light bands appeared near the centromeric site in all the autosomes whereas the specific dark bands were consistently visible in each homologous chromosome. Overall, the G-banding pattern was nearly identical between the Chickso and Hanwoo. C-bands representing the heterochromatin were present at or near the centromere in all the autosomes, whereas in sex chromosomes, they were found distributed on variable sites. The proportion of constitutive heterochromatin ranged 20∼30%. These patterns were not significantly different between the two subspecies. All of these cytogenetic results suggest that the distinctive traits of Chickso did not arise from a cytogenetic variation from Hanwoo, i. e. the former is simply a subpopulation of the latter. As such, we propose that selection and propagation of the Chickso based on economic traits may be advantageous to the domestic beef industry.

      • 콘크리트 Pump Car의 구조 개선을 위한 유한요소해석

        전종균,엄호성,김도형,김영해 선문대학교 ·중소기업기술지원연구소 2002 선문공대 연구/기술 논문집 Vol.7 No.1

        유한요소 해석법은 컴퓨터의 발달로 인해 근래에 들어 많은 진보를 거듭하고 있다. 또한, 이를 이용한 제품 개발과 많은 연구가 진행되고 있는 실정에 있다. 본 논문은 콘크리트 Pump Car의 구조 개선을 위해 FEM해석을 실시하였다. 각 BOOM과 Swing post를 단순화, 모델링하여 각 Boom에 작용하는 응력 및 변형률을 해석하였고, Swing post의 Bolt 부분의 위치 변화에 따른 응력 분포와 변형률을 계산하였으며, 해석 값은 등가응력 Von-Mises Stress 과 변형률 USUM 로 측정하였다. Recently FEA has been improved by the growth of computer technology. Also research for solid mechanics is more activated and new product has been developed by the support of FEA. In this study, the structure of pump car for concrete has been analyzed using FEA for the optimal performance. Each structure of boom and swing post are simplified for modelling and the stress and strain on the elements of them has been analyzed. The stress distribution and strain of swing post for various position of bolt has been determined and analytic value for the equvalent stress Von-Mises Stress and strain USUM has been calculated.

      • 洋蘭 生長點 培養에 關한 硏究 : (Ⅳ) Auxin 과 kinetin의 單用및 混用處理가 Cymbidium의 生育에 미치는 影響 (Ⅳ) Effect of auxin alone or combined with kinetin on growth of Cymbidium species

        全在琪,徐榮敎,鄭載東 慶北大學校 1979 論文集 Vol.28 No.-

        The promoting effects in the previous papers were obtained on the several Cymbidium varieties by treatment of auxin or kinetin alone. The concentrations of auxin and kinetin promoting growth of mericlones and proliferation of protocorms were chosen. Now, auxin or kinetin alone and in combination were applicated in this experiment to examine the effects on growth of Cymbidium and Cymbidium elcapitan. The results obtained were as follows. ① Survival ratio of Cymbidium wakakusa was higher in auxin alone, while that of Cymbidium elcapitan did in auxin and kinetin combined, but plant height of both varieties was retarded in combined medium with auxin and kinetin. ② Rooting was promoted by addition of growth regulators than control plot, especially, 0.5ppm NAA and 15.0ppm IBA showed high rooting ratio by 100%. ③ 1.0ppm IAA promoted plant height, 0.1ppm NAA, root growth, but protocorm proliferation was good at control and 1.5ppm kinetin in Cymbidium wakakusa, while plant height was higher in 15.0ppm IBA, root growth, in 0.5ppm NAA, and protocorm proliferation, 1.0ppm NAA and 15.0ppm IBA+1.5ppm kinetin in Cymbidium elcapitan.

      • 서울地方의 TROMBICULID MITES : 特히 그 醫學的 意義에 對하여

        全鍾暉,鄭喜泳 서울대학교 1958 서울대학교 論文集 Vol.7 No.-

        The purpose of this study is to investigate the vector species of trombiculid mites of Scrub typhus and Epidemic hemorrhagic fever from the medical entomological viewpoint in Korea. The authors made a careful survey of the trombiculid mites on the indigeneous Rodentia, Insectivora, Chiroptera, Aves, Amphibia and Reptilia n the vicinity of Seoul during the period from January 1956 to December 1956. 1. A total of 5666 trombiculid mites were collected from a total of 3349 animals. The species of these hosts are shown table 1. 2. The following species of trombiculid mites were identified, Trombicula tamiyai T. nagayoi T. japonica T. mitamurai (collected for the first time in Korea) T. pomeranzevi ( ¨) T. orientalis T. palpalis T. pallida T. subintermedius T. myotis T. scutellaris (collected for the first time in Korea) Euschongastia kitajimai E. koreaensis E. miyagawai (collected for the first time in Korea) Gahrliepia brennani var. ventralis

        부비동 점액낭종의 수술적 치험 : 4 Cases

        장영록,정석원,김창수,전병찬,박용구,유태현,천태상,이화동 대한신경외과학회 1988 Journal of Korean neurosurgical society Vol.17 No.5

        Mucocele is collection of mucus enclosed in a sac of lining sinus epithelium within an air sinus resulting from an obstruction to the outlet of the cavity which may cause an expansion of the bony walls. The condition commonly occurs in the frontal or anterior ethmoidal sinuses but, rare in sphenoid sinuses. Mucocele of the sinus is an uncommon cause of unilateral proptosis which may produce considerable difficulty in diagnosis. Ocular disturbances and headache are among the characteristic complaints and patients often first consult an ophyhalmologist or otolaryngologist. The authors experienced four cases of paranasal sinuse mucocele. There were 2 posterior ethmoid sinus mucoceles, 1 giant frontal sinus mucocele and 1 sphenoid sinus mucocele. These cases presented with exophthalmos, proptosis, headache or frontal mass. All cases removed by surgical procedures and good result was obstained.
